Just a small thing that I am finding very good while taming my guinea pigs is not to chase them around when you want to pick them up. Just imagine that something 50 times the size was chasing you around a cage, you would be fairly scared. Instead try to pick them up while they are in a hideys...

I'm just reading through this thread, and I just want to say that hay is a very difficult crop to get right. Even one shower of rain can completely destroy a whole crop of drying hay. It is never going to be perfect every time from any source. If you really want to be sure of the hays quality...
